HUAWEI-WLAN-GLOBAL-MIB

AI MIB Summary

The HUAWEI-WLAN-GLOBAL-MIB module monitors global state and performance metrics for Huawei wireless LAN controllers, specifically tracking Layer 3 roaming statistics for associated stations via the hwWlanCurrentL3RoamStaCnt counter. This MIB facilitates the collection of critical roaming data required for capacity planning and troubleshooting mobility issues within the wireless infrastructure.
